What is it about?

This article describes how still, TV, and internet photojournalists work together in the field, and how their approaches to stories compares and contrasts.

Featured Image

Why is it important?

Photojournalists who shoot stills need different kinds of territory and access than TV Photojournalists, and professionals shooting video for the web have different needs as well. Its important to understand how their work is shaped by the needs of various media.
